body {
	font: 1em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	background: #000000;
}
#container #content #albumpreview {
}


#header {
}
#container #header #logo {
	position: absolute;
	top: 20px;
}
#content {
	height: 460px;
	width: 640px;
}
#leftpanel {
	position: absolute;
	left: 745px;
	width: 200px;
	z-index: 1;
	top: 155px;
}

#container #content #slideshow #album {
	background: #303030;
}


.blacktext {
	color: #000000;
}
#container #content #slideshow #div #text {
	background: #303030;
	margin: 0px;
	white-space: normal;
	padding: 10px;
	line-height: 1.1em;
	font-size: 100%;
	font-family: Arial, Helvetica, sans-serif;
}
h1 {
	font-size: 140%;
	color: #3399FF;
	font-weight: normal;
	background: repeat;
	text-transform: uppercase;
}




#container #footer {
	vertical-align: bottom;
	position: absolute;
	top: 557px;
	width: 955px;
	font-size: 70%;
	z-index: 101;
}
#container {
	width: 985px;
	margin-top: 0px;
	margin-right: auto;
	margin-bottom: 0px;
	margin-left: auto;
	display: block;
}
.lilaclink {
	color: #CC99FF;
	text-decoration: underline;
}


#container #header #address {
	font: 13px Arial, Helvetica, sans-serif;
	width: 250px;
	text-align: center;
	height: auto;
	white-space: normal;
	display: block;
	vertical-align: top;
	position: absolute;
	left: 720px;
	top: 85px;
}
#container #header #address #homelogo {
	text-align: center;
	font-size: 130%;
	font-weight: bold;
	text-decoration: underline;
	position: absolute;
	left: -680px;
	top: -70px;
}


#container #footer #footer1 {
	width: 200px;
}

#container #footer #footer2 {
	width: 300px;
	height: auto;
	position: absolute;
	top: 0px;
	left: 245px;
}


#container #footer #footer3 {
	width: 250px;
	position: absolute;
	top: 0px;
	left: 490px;
}
.yellowtext {
	font-size: 150%;
	color: #FFFF00;
}






#container #leftpanel #leftpanel3 {
	position: absolute;
	left: 80px;
	text-align: center;
	top: 530px;
}
#container #header #menu {
	top: 53px;
	margin: 0px;
	z-index: 10;
	font-weight: normal;
	text-transform: lowercase;
	list-style: none;
	height: 23px;
	width: 421px;
	padding-top: 3px;
	padding-right: 0px;
	padding-bottom: 0px;
	padding-left: 0px;
	background-image: url(test/images/photosmenubackground.gif);
	background-repeat: no-repeat;
}
.linknoblueline {
	text-decoration: none;
}

#container #header #menu li {
	display: inline;
	margin-top: 0em;
	margin-right: 0em;
	margin-bottom: 0em;
	margin-left: 2em;
	position: relative;
	left: -10px;
	padding-top: 0px;
	padding-right: 0px;
	padding-bottom: 0px;
	padding-left: 1px;
}
.textyellow {
	color: #FFFF00;
	text-decoration: none;
}


#container #header #menu a:link {
	color: #FFFFFF;
	text-decoration: none;
}
#container #header #menu a:visited {
	color: #FFFFFF;
	text-decoration: none;
}
#container #header #menu a:hover {
	color: #FFFF00;
	text-decoration: none;
}
#container #header #menu a:active {
	color: #FFFFFF;
	text-decoration: none;
}



#container #leftpanel #leftpanel1 {
	top: 130px;
	text-align: center;
	width: 200px;
	font-weight: bold;
}
#container #leftpanel #passwordfield {
	width: 190px;
	padding: 0px;
	top: 330px;
	text-align: center;
	white-space: normal;
	display: compact;
	height: 30px;
	left: 0px;
	margin: 0px;
}

#container #leftpanel #leftpanel2 {
	position: absolute;
	top: 258px;
	text-align: center;
	font-size: 14px;
	width: 200px;
	font-family: Arial, Helvetica, sans-serif;
	color: #FFFFFF;
}
.demo {
	font-family: Arial, Helvetica, sans-serif;
	font-weight: bold;
}



.yellowtextsmall {

	font-size: 120%;
	color: #FFFF00;
}

.boldwhitetext {
	font-weight: bold;
}
a.lilac:link {

	color: #CC99FF;
	text-decoration: none;
}

a.lilac:visited {


	color: #CC99FF;
	text-decoration: none;
}
a.lilac:hover {



	color: #CC99FF;
	text-decoration: underline;
}
a.lilac:active {




	color: #CC99FF;
	text-decoration: none;
}
#container #header img {
	position: relative;
	left: 700px;
}
#container #header #logo #PREVIEW {
	position: relative;
	left: 20px;
}
#container #content #slideshow {
	position: absolute;
	top: 78px;
	left: 45px;
	margin: 1px;
	padding: 0px;
	background: #000000;
	border: 1px solid #999999;
}
#container #content #slideshow #div {
	height: 460px;
	width: 640px;
	background: #000000;
}
#container #content #slideshow #logos #weddings {
	top: 20px;
	background: #000000;
	margin: 0px 20px 20px;
	width: auto;
}
#group {
}
#group #offer {
	position: absolute;
	left: 315px;
	top: 144px;
}
